Output 89f5bb176cd881009d1aeec7be69264bfa45040222f8cec74cdcfffcb0214909:0

value
1497691975
script pubkey
OP_0 OP_PUSHBYTES_20 622e93c5b264aaf0381b8d160a12f1a9ffd76268
address
ltc1qvghf83djvj40qwqm35tq5yh348lawcngkqlmra
transaction
89f5bb176cd881009d1aeec7be69264bfa45040222f8cec74cdcfffcb0214909
spent
true